Ikpeazu appoints Igbe as Abia College of Health Rector

Governor Okezie Ikpeazu of Abia State has appointed Dr Osita Igbe as the new Rector of Abia State College of Health Sciences and Management, Aba.

Igbe, who is a university lecturer and former Chairman of Isuikwuato LGA, is to replace Maduakolam Nwogwugwu.

Ikpeazu in a statement signed by Barr Chris Ezem, Secretary to the State government, said the appointment was with immediate effect.

Maduakolam Nwogwugwu was appointed last month by the Governor.
